This script face is built from tall, slender letterforms with pronounced vertical emphasis and dramatic stroke modulation. Hairline entry and exit strokes contrast with darker downstrokes, creating a calligraphic rhythm and a lightly textured, pen-drawn finish. Terminals are frequently tapered or looped, with occasional swashes and airy counters that keep the texture open despite the condensed proportions. Uppercase forms are especially elongated and expressive, while lowercase maintains a consistent, upright flow with intermittent connections and varied joining behavior that reads as hand-crafted rather than mechanical.

This font is best suited to short, prominent settings such as wedding suites, event collateral, boutique branding, product packaging, and editorial or social headlines. It can also work for pull quotes or small blocks of text when set generously with extra tracking and comfortable line spacing to preserve its fine hairlines and looping details.

The overall tone feels refined and slightly playful, mixing formal calligraphy cues with a breezy, handwritten charm. Its high-contrast strokes and looping terminals convey romance and sophistication, while the narrow, vertical posture adds a fashion-forward, boutique character.

The design appears intended to emulate an elegant pointed-pen script with a contemporary, condensed silhouette. It prioritizes expressive capitals, sharp contrast, and graceful loops to deliver a decorative signature style that stands out in display typography.

In running text the rhythm is lively, with noticeable alternation between thin connectors and heavier stems. The very small x-height and tall ascenders lend a decorative, display-first personality; spacing appears intentionally light, and letter-to-letter fit can feel tight in dense words, reinforcing its ornamental look.
